Why use Nairobi residential proxies?
East Africa's Commercial Hub
Nairobi is the headquarters for most multinational and pan-African operations across East Africa. Companies tracking pricing, content, and competitor activity in the region need Kenyan IPs to see what local users actually see on Jumia, Kilimall, and Sky Garden.
Real Kenyan ISP IPs
Our Nairobi pool includes IPs from Safaricom Home Fibre, Zuku Fiber, Faiba (JTL), Telkom Kenya, and Airtel Kenya. Target sites see genuine residential traffic from real Kenyan households, not datacenter ranges flagged by anti-bot systems.
Mobile Money and Fintech Capital
Nairobi's Silicon Savannah powers M-Pesa and a wave of fintech platforms serving the continent. Local IPs are essential for accurate testing, fraud research, and competitive monitoring on Kenyan banking, lending, and mobile money services.
City-Level Targeting
Pin requests to Nairobi directly in your proxy credentials. Traffic exits through IPs physically located in the metro area, giving accurate localized results for SERP tracking, ad verification, and price intelligence across Kenyan platforms.
What you can do with Nairobi proxies
Common use cases for Nairobi residential proxy connections.
E-Commerce Price Monitoring
Track Kenyan pricing on Jumia Kenya, Kilimall, Sky Garden, and Masoko. Monitor flash sales, shipping costs, and seller behavior as a local Nairobi shopper would see them.
Local SEO and SERP Tracking
Monitor Google.co.ke rankings, local pack results, and Google Maps listings as they appear to Nairobi searchers across both desktop and mobile.
Ad Verification in Kenya
Confirm geo-targeted campaigns render correctly for Kenyan audiences on Meta, Google, YouTube, and local publishers like Nation Media and Standard Group.
Ride-Hailing and Delivery Data
Collect pricing, ETAs, and availability from Bolt, Uber, Little Cab, Glovo, and Jumia Food across Nairobi neighborhoods at different times of day.
Fintech and Market Research
Research Kenyan fintech, lending apps, and M-Pesa-integrated services from a local vantage point. Useful for competitive analysis and risk teams.
Travel and Hospitality Scraping
Aggregate Kenyan hotel rates, safari packages, and flight prices from Jumia Travel, Booking, and local OTAs that adjust pricing by visitor geography.
